Originally from Los Angeles, Matthew has also spent time living in Ashville North Carolina, St Louis Missouri, and Victoria, British Columbia. 

 

Matthew first came to Bend as a CCT client, drawn here by the ample outdoor activities. After graduating from CCT, Matthew spent time working as a Direct Support Professional, assisting clients with independent living skills and self-advocacy. Matthew then decided to go back to school, getting an associate degree from COCC in Bend. After that, Matthew moved to Eugene to continue his education, earning a bachelor's in Anthropology with a minor in sports business from the University of Oregon in Eugene.  Matthew moved back to Bend to work at CCT.

 

Matthew loves sports, both playing and watching. He played hockey throughout his childhood before moving to Canada to play in high school. While at the University of Oregon, Matthew played for the Rugby team and helped reestablish the rugby program after COVID temporarily shut down the sport. While not at work, Matthew spends his time cooking, watching sports, or hiking with his dog.
